Who we are looking for We are seeking experienced creative Interior Designers with background working in Architectural Firms on various types of Commercial Tenant Improvement projects. This is an exciting opportunity for a skilled Interior Designer looking to grow, lead, and make a meaningful impact within a supportive and collaborative team. Qualifications 8+years of experience in Commercial Tenant Improvement projects Bachelors degree from an accredited Interior Design school Successful completion of NCIDQ and Registration as RID Responsibilities Manage various Commercial Tenant Improvement and Interior Projects Work with our clients to determine programming requirements and establish project goals/objectives. Bring a high level of creativity and design excellence to each project Prepare compelling and informative presentations Prepare 3D modeling during design development to clearly convey the design intent to the client. Research, gather, recommend, and present appropriate finishes, fixture and furnishings that capture the functional, aesthetic, environmental, and budgetary requirements of the project.
